The Official Route (with a Twist)
Now, Walmart themselves won't give you straight-up cash for your gift card. But, depending on your state's laws, they might be obligated to offer a refund in cash if the balance is under a certain amount. So, crack open Google Maps and search for "cash refund for gift card laws in [your state]". Knowledge is power, my friends!

The Wild West: The Online Frontier of Gift Card Exchanging
The internet, oh glorious internet, offers a treasure trove of online marketplaces dedicated to trading and selling gift cards. These platforms allow you to list your Walmart gift card and connect with potential buyers who are willing to fork over some cash (well, technically, digital cash) in exchange.
However, be cautious, friends! Just like venturing into the Wild West, navigating the online realm of gift card exchange requires a healthy dose of skepticism. Research the platform thoroughly, read reviews, and never share any personal information until you're absolutely confident about the legitimacy of the buyer.
